004 | Cairo with G. Willow Wilson

from The comiXologist podcast! · host comiXology

G. Willow Wilson talks about her graphic novel Cairo, shipping this week from Vertigo, about her experiences as a journalist in Egypt, and about the influences that have shaped her writings both in and out of comic books.
